What will I learn?

Gain the in-depth knowledge of finance and banking, risk management as well as elevating your skills in-line with increased workplace demand. Gain the expertise you need to upskill and specialise in your career. Our MSc Banking, Finance and Risk Management will help you develop the knowlege and skills to: Conduct research in business and management Understand wealth management solutions Develop risk management strategies Learning Choose a pathway that works for you. You'll work in high-spec facilities, like our Business Laboratory and Bloomberg Trading Room, and discuss current issues facing businesses and financial services in peer-to-peer debates and case studies. You’ll also have the chance to pursue a consultancy project with either a multinational corporation or a prominent SME in London.

Entry requirements

For international students

You should usually hold a second-class honours degree (certain programmes may require a 2:1) from a recognised British or overseas university. Non-graduates with appropriate professional qualifications will be considered on an individual basis by Programme Leaders. Applicants will be expected to apply and register for the full masters award. If you have a third-class honours degree, we encourage you to complete an application as we will consider your wider circumstances in making a decision on your application.
